[Music] [Applause] [Music] [Applause] I was born in a refugee camp in Thailand in 1984. A few years ago, I met this doctor who actually worked at that camp, right. And you know what he said to me.He said, "Did you know that one and out of three babies that were born in that camp in Veni didn't make it past their second birthday?" My parents were was in that camp for 10 years, you know. And in while they were there in that camp, they had three babies. And in 1987, we landed here and came to America.Statistic ...
